The Pervasive Power and Puzzling Problems of Chlordane

Chlordane, chemically known as 1,2,4,5,6,7,8,8-octachloro-3a,4,7,7a-tetrahydro-4,7-methanoindane, was a synthetic organochlorine insecticide. Its primary use was in agriculture for controlling a broad spectrum of pests, including termites, ants, and grasshoppers. Beyond its agricultural applications, it was also employed domestically for pest control in and around homes.

  • Key Applications
    • Termite control in buildings
    • Control of soil insects in agriculture
    • Lawn and garden pest management
    • Ant and cockroach eradication

The effectiveness of chlordane stemmed from its persistent nature. It didn’t break down easily in the environment, meaning it provided long-lasting protection against pests. However, this same persistence became its downfall. As chlordane accumulated in soil, water, and the bodies of living organisms, it began to pose significant threats. As research progressed, evidence mounted regarding chlordane’s detrimental effects. These concerns primarily revolved around its potential carcinogenicity, its disruption of endocrine systems, and its tendency to bioaccumulate up the food chain. These findings painted a grim picture of a chemical that, while once lauded for its insect-killing prowess, was proving to be a significant environmental and health hazard.
